Services Arc Flash Assessment and Analysis Industry standards are in place to address these electrical hazards, and provide guidance to employers and their employees to help them understand how to protect themselves from these hazards. CSA Z462 Workplace Electrical Safety is one such consensus standard that provides very detailed guidance. Industrial Hygiene Industrial Hygiene -- Building Health Sciences Pre-Start Reviews Pre Start Health and Safety Reviews in compliance with Section 7 of the Regulation for Industrial Establishment: Flammable liquids, Machine guarding including interlocks and electronic guarding devices, Racking and Stacking Structures, Processes that may produce an explosion such as spray booth, Dust Collectors, Lifting devices Waste Water Management A wastewater management plant should address the following objectives: Achieve regulatory compliance | Minimize cost | Demonstrate environmental stewardship.
